Market at a Turning Point: Nifty50's Next Big MoveThe chart provided is a daily timeframe analysis of the Nifty50 index, showing key technical levels and possible trade scenarios based on price action. It presents an opportunity for traders to assess potential breakout or breakdown levels and make informed trading decisions.
1. Current Market Scenario (Price Action Analysis)
The Nifty 50 index is currently trading at 23092. The index is moving within a descending triangle pattern, forming lower highs while maintaining support at key levels. Price is consolidating in a narrow range, indicating uncertainty and indecisiveness in the market.
2. Key Technical Zones Identified
A. Resistance Zone (Red Area)
The resistance zone is marked with a downward sloping trendline, highlighting consistent selling pressure. Nifty has faced multiple rejections around this trendline, indicating strong resistance levels. If the index breaks above this level with volume, it could signal the start of a bullish trend.
Key Levels:
Resistance at 23,600 - 24,000. A breakout above 24,000 could lead to a rally towards 25,200-25,600 levels.
B. Support Zone (Green Area)
The support zone represents a crucial price area where buying interest has historically emerged. This zone is critical for maintaining the current trend; breaking below could lead to a bearish continuation. If the index holds this level, it could provide a strong base for an upward move.
Key Levels:
Support at 22,800 - 23,000. A breakdown below 22,800 may trigger a decline towards 21,500-21,000 levels.
C. Monthly Timeframe Support Zone (Thicker Green Line)
A long-term support level derived from a higher timeframe (monthly chart). This level is significant, acting as a major inflection point for long-term investors. A breakdown below this zone may signal a shift in long-term sentiment.
Key Levels:
Strong support around 22,500. A sustained break could lead to deeper corrections.
D. Consolidation Zone (Circled Area)
Nifty is currently consolidating within a tight range inside the descending triangle. This phase usually precedes a strong directional move (either up or down). Traders should wait for confirmation before initiating new positions.

NQ Technical chartNQ Analysis
Examining the overall 4-hour trend, we observe a pattern in the downward and upward price movements:
Downward Move (AB): From 22,428.75 to 21,016.75.
Retracement (BC): The upward retracement of BC was exactly 78.6% of the total downward move (AB). Price action moved up to this level before rejecting.
Similarly:
After rejecting at 22,118.75, the price dropped to retest at 20,983.75.
This resulted in another upward retracement (DE) to 21,872.75, which again represented 78.6% of the previous downward move (CD).
On Friday, the lowest tick on NQ was recorded at 20,874.75.
If we apply Fibonacci to the most recent downward move:
The 78.6% retracement level is at 21,674.00, marking a potential area of interest above.
Below, the open areas of interest are:
78.6% retracement at 20,803.50
88.6% retracement at 20,605.75
This highlights key zones for potential price action and reaction points moving forward.

Textbook Reversal Setup: Liquidity Zone + Channel BreakReversal Setup Analysis: HTF Liquidity Zone + Ascending Channel Breakdown
This chart highlights a high-probability bearish reversal setup based on key technical confluences. Here’s a step-by-step breakdown of the analysis:
1. High-Timeframe (HTF) Liquidity Zone (LQZ):
- The red zone marks a major HTF supply area where price previously rejected with a strong impulsive move downward. This liquidity zone is critical as it represents an area where institutional players have shown activity, creating a high-probability region for a potential reversal.
- As price approached this zone again, it did so in a corrective manner (via an ascending channel), which indicates weakening bullish momentum.
2. Impulsive vs. Corrective Structures:
- Impulsive Move: The strong move away from the HTF LQZ (highlighted earlier in the chart) confirms bearish intent, serving as a key reference point for this trade idea.
Corrective Structure: The price forms an ascending channel on the way back to retest the HTF LQZ, signaling exhaustion of buyers.
- The third touch of the channel’s trendline coincides with the HTF LQZ, adding confluence for a potential bearish reversal.
3. Liquidity Zones in Play:
- HTF Liquidity Zone (Supply): Serves as the key resistance level and primary rejection zone.
- 15-Minute Liquidity Zone (Demand): Acts as a potential target for bearish momentum post-breakdown.
- This multi-timeframe liquidity alignment strengthens the trade idea by providing clear areas of interest for entry, stop-loss, and take-profit placement.
4. Breakdown Entry and Structure:
- Entry Trigger: The trade is triggered on the break of structure, where price falls through the lower boundary of the ascending channel. This breakdown confirms bearish momentum resuming after the corrective phase.
- Stop-Loss Placement: Ideally placed above the HTF liquidity zone and beyond the third touch of the channel to account for potential fake-outs.
- Take-Profit Levels: Targets can be set near the 15M liquidity zone or prior swing lows for a solid risk-to-reward ratio.
5. Key Takeaways:
- This setup offers an excellent example of combining HTF liquidity zones, structural patterns, and market context to develop a high-probability trade idea. The rejection from the HTF LQZ aligns with the broader bearish narrative, while the ascending channel acts as a corrective structure leading to a continuation of the downward move.
- By focusing on confluence factors like liquidity zones, impulsive vs. corrective moves, and structural breaks, this trade idea demonstrates a disciplined and strategic approach to trading reversals.
Educational Insights:
- Always zoom out to identify HTF zones of significance to ensure alignment with the larger market context.
- Differentiate between impulsive and corrective structures to gauge the strength and intent of price movements.
- Use pattern confluences (e.g., ascending channels) in combination with key zones to identify high-probability entries.
- Prioritize patience and discipline by waiting for clear structural breaks to confirm your setup.
